| Places at stake after defeat - Arthur |
Mickey Arthur, South Africa's coach, didn't pull any punches after his side were thrashed by 126 runs at The Oval to surrender the one-day series against England at the earliest possible moment. He put pressure on senior figures to play for their futures and said it was time for the side to starting looking ahead.

| Patel grabs five as England claim series |
Andrew Flintoff starred with bat and ball, Ian Bell played arguably the most fluent one-day innings of his career and Samit Patel capped a sparky allround performance with a maiden five-wicket haul, as England's cricketers surged to an unassailable 3-0 series lead in Kevin Pietersen's first series as captain.

| Gloucestershire sign Dawson |
Gloucestershire have signed former England offspinner Richard Dawson, who has been without a first-class county since being released by Northamptonshire. Dawson has committed the next two years with the club.

| ICC Awards to be held in Dubai |
The fifth ICC Awards will be held in Dubai on September 10, after plans to stage the event at Lahore fell through with the postponement of the Champions Trophy.

| Tennis elbow ends Smith's tour |
Graeme Smith will miss the three remaining matches of South Africa's one-day tour of England, and is unlikely to play again until the tour of Australia in December.
